GMTC concluded the basic first aid course, which lasted for four consecutive days, with the participation of (29) trainees from various security services.
During the course, participants received a set of basic knowledge and skills, including: principles of first aid, ambulance bag, injury assessment and determining ambulance priorities, evacuation, communication skills, and dealing with injuries and burns, ensuring optimal exploitation of available capabilities and providing effective primary medical care that contributes to preserving the lives of the injured.
In his speech during the graduation ceremony, the Commander of CTI Staff Brigadier / Ashraf Abu Sultan, stressed the importance of this course in raising the level of field readiness of members of the security services, stressing that possessing first aid skills constitutes an essential element in protecting lives and enhancing public safety while performing tasks, especially in emergency circumstances and various field situations.
At the conclusion of the ceremony, the trainees graduated, and emphasis was placed on the continued implementation of specialized courses that contribute to developing the professional capabilities of members of the security services.
